Volume 3 of the Handbook of Temperature Measurement, prepared by the CSIRO National Measurement Laboratory, Australia, covers the principles behind the behaviour and misbehaviour of thermocouples and gives detailed information on the properties of common thermocouple materials. It also discusses the use of thermocouples and their calibration. Other topics include the calculation of uncertainties and the problems of multi-site measurements (e.g. furnace testing). The text is entirely authored by Robin E. Bentley.

Volume 2 of the Handbook of Temperature Measurement, prepared by the CSIRO National Measurement Laboratory, Australia, discusses the operation, calibration and usage of resistance and liquid-in-glass thermometers. Both standard-platinum-resistance thermometers and industrial-resistance thermometers are examined, and details on a variety of resistance-measuring techniques are given. Also included is a final version of the official text of the International Temperature Scale 1990 (ITS-90). The authors of this volume are John J. Connolly and E. Corina Horrigan.

Volume 1 of the Handbook of Temperature Measurement, prepared by the CSIRO National Measurement Laboratory, Australia, details the principles and techniques involved in the measurement of humidity, in cryogenic and radiation thermometry and a variety of unconventional methods of temperature measurement. Other topics considered are thermal conductivity and the traceability of measurement. Authors in this volume include Mark J. Ballico, Edwin C. Morris, Gary Rosengarten, Anna Schneider, Glenda Sandars, Laurie M. Besley, Jeffrey Tapping, and Anthony J. Farmer.
